What can karyotype analysis detect?

Karyotype analysis can be used to easily determine sex and a number of genetic disorders, such as Down's Syndrome (trisomy-21) or Klinefelter's Syndrome (XXY).


What information can be obtained about a fetus from a karyotype?

A karyotype can provide information about the number, size, and shape of an individual's chromosomes. This can help detect chromosomal abnormalities such as Down syndrome or Turner syndrome in a fetus.


What can be diagnosed by examining a karyotype of an individuals white blood cells?

A karyotype of an individual's white blood cells can be used to diagnose chromosomal abnormalities such as Down syndrome, Turner syndrome, and Klinefelter syndrome. It can also detect genetic disorders caused by aneuploidy or large structural chromosomal changes.

How do you detect down syndrome?

If you test for it in pregnancy the test is called a CVS or an Amniocentesis. They test the amniotic fluid or a piece of the babys' placenta for the third 21st chromosome. After birth, they take some blood from the baby and run what is called a Karyotype. That test will count the chromosomes in the cells of the blood and if there are 3 21st chromosomes that means Down Syndrome


What type of disorders are karyotyping used to diagnose?

Chromosomal disorders can be observed in a human karyotype. It can show whether there are extra chromosomes, or missing chromosomes, or malformed chromosomes, or whether chromosomes have extra pieces, or missing pieces.


How is karyotype used by genetics?

a karyotype is a picture of all the chromosomes in a cell. These pictures are used to check for chromosomal abnormalities, such as too few or too much which can result in a genetic disability. Such as Down Syndrome.
